      The Mexican Drum is a competition featured on the podcast "Kill Tony" where two drummers go head-to-head in a drum solo, with the winner getting the opportunity to become the new drummer on the show and fly back to Los Angeles. The undefeated drummer, Joel Bertoll, was challenged by Jordan Mack, and the crowd was excited for the close competition. Although Jordan gave a great performance, Joel retained his title as the reigning champion. The podcast also featured some unexpected humor and banter from behind the curtain.
